PROBLEM TO BE SOLVED : To flatten the distribution of magnetic flux density in the center axis direction of a magnet roller. SOLUTION : A magnet block 33A formed of a rare earth magnet and having a highly magnetic force is disposed in an accommodating groove 32a formed in the peripheral part of the magnet roller 32A, which corresponds to the developing pole P1 of the magnet roller 40A. In this case, the magnet block 33A is formed so that the characteristic that is almost opposite to that of the distribution of the magnetic flux density of the magnet roller 32A in the direction of the center axis 31 in the accommodating groove 32a of the magnet roller 32A is exhibited in the lengthwise direction of the magnet block 33A. Specifically, the magnet block 33A is concaved such that both the lengthwise ends 33a and 33b of the magnet block 33A project more than its lengthwise middle section in the widthwise direction of the magnet block 33A and the cross sectional area of each of the lengthwise ends of the magnet block 33A is larger than that of the middle section.
